SammendragThe Bayesian Stochastic Block Model (Bayesian SBM) is a principled probabilistic method for community detection in networks. It treats group membership as a latent variable and uses Bayesian inference to simultaneously recover block structure and select the number of communities, avoiding the resolution-limit bias that plagues modularity-based approaches.The Multilayer Stochastic Block Model (ML-SBM) is a generative probabilistic framework that extends the classical stochastic block model to networks with multiple relation types or layers. It simultaneously infers community structure and block-to-block connection probabilities across all layers, capturing how communities cohere differently depending on context or relationship type.
